Abstract

The utility model discloses a mobile phone-fixed phone conversion device. The mobile phone-fixed phone conversion device comprises a mobile phone communication module, a main control module and a fixed phone signal digital conversion module, wherein the mobile phone communication module, the main control module and the fixed phone signal digital conversion module are sequentially connected; and the mobile phone communication module performs data interaction with a mobile phone, then data of the mobile phone is sent to the fixed phone signal digital conversion module via the main control module, converted to a fixed phone signal, and then sent to a fixed phone, after that, the fixed phone signal of the fixed phone is converted to a digital coded signal via the fixed phone signal digital conversion module, sent to the main control module, and processed into voice data of conversation and data for controlling the mobile phone to work, and then sent to the mobile phone via the mobile phone communication module, thus realizing bidirectional interaction between the mobile phone and the fixed phone; in this way, a user can answer the mobile callings of the mobile phone via the fixed phone, thus reducing the influence of mobile phone radiation on the body, and solving the problem of discomfort caused by the heating of the mobile phone due to long-time phoning.

See also Fig. 1, Fig. 1 is the structured flowchart of the utility model mobile phone fixed line conversion equipment.As shown in Figure 1, described mobile phone fixed line conversion equipment 100 comprises: mobile communication module 110, main control module 120 and fixed line signal digital modular converter 130; Described mobile communication module 110, main control module 120 and fixed line signal digital modular converter are connected successively and are connected.Described mobile communication module 110 is used for carrying out data interaction with mobile phone 300.Described main control module 120 is used for mobile communication module 110 and mobile phone 300 mutual data are sent to fixed line signal digital modular converter 130 and the digitally encoded signal of fixed line signal digital modular converter 130 is treated to the speech data of conversation and the data of control mobile phone 300 work.Described fixed line signal digital modular converter 130 is used for fixed line signal with switch 210 and is sent to base 220, the data that main control module 120 is that send and mobile phone 300 is mutual are converted to the fixed line signal are sent to base 220, and the fixed line signal of base 220 is converted to digitally encoded signal is sent to main control module 120.
Specifically, the mobile communication module 110 that the utility model provides, main control module 120 and fixed line signal digital modular converter 130, the data interaction between them is two-way interactive.Described mobile communication module 110 is carried out data interaction by wired or wireless mode and mobile phone 300, and the content of transmission comprises digitized control command and audio-frequency information.Described mobile communication module 110 can be bluetooth module, thereby can carry out adaptively with mobile phone 300, realizes that wireless data is mutual.Described mobile communication module 110 can also with mobile phone 300 wired connections, carry out data interaction.Further, be provided with at least one and mobile phone 300 carries out the mutual interface of cable data at described mobile phone fixed line conversion equipment 100.Described interface comprises USB interface, audio interface or serial ports.Described mobile communication module 110 not only sends to main control module 120 with the mobile telephone signal of mobile phone 300, and the data of the control mobile phone 300 that also main control module 120 is sent send to mobile phone 300.Described mobile phone fixed line conversion equipment 100 can adopt the physical structure of many interfaces." many interfaces " is except the connecting interface of finger with mobile phone, also refer to be provided with Micro USB(portable general series buss) interface, audio interface, Serial Port Line, with the audio interface of line traffic control etc. various wireline interfaces, as long as can realize the transmission of control command and audio frequency; Also can be that a plurality of identical interfaces are provided simultaneously, thereby connect plurality of mobile phones 300.Fixed line signal digital modular converter 130 in the mobile phone fixed line conversion equipment 100 that the utility model provides can also connect a plurality of bases 220.
Described main control module 120 comprises main control chip and related peripheral circuit, the main major function that realizes mobile phone fixed line conversion seat 100, mobile communication module 110 and mobile phone 300 mutual data are sent to fixed line signal digital modular converter 130, such as the voice signal in the mobile phone.Simultaneously, it is two-way interactive between the three, described main control module 120 also is treated to the digitally encoded signal of fixed line signal digital modular converter 130 data of control mobile phone 300 work, sends to mobile phone 300 through mobile phone communication module 110, thereby control mobile phone 300 is answered or hung up the telephone etc.The digitally encoded signal of described fixed line signal digital modular converter 130 is to be converted to digitally encoded signal by its fixed line signal with base 220 to send to main control module 120, identify and be treated to the data of control mobile phone 300 through main control module 120, send to mobile phone 300 through mobile phone communication module 110 again, thereby corresponding control mobile phone is realized corresponding operation.The fixed line signal of described base 220 comprises voice signal and the operation information of user on base 220, and the operation information of described user on base 220 comprises the push button signalling of off hook signal, on-hook signal and user's input etc.Described main control module 120 can use any integrated chip with enough Resources on Chips to realize, such as enough FLASH, ROM, RAM, high speed dominant frequency etc., the main realization the digitized signal after 130 conversions of fixed line signal digital modular converter, be treated to instruction or the voice signal of control mobile phone 300, be transferred on the mobile phone 300 by mobile communication module 110; Also the voice data of mobile phone 300 is exported relevant voice signal by fixed line signal digital modular converter 130 at telephone wire simultaneously, thereby realize the mobile phone of answering cell phones 300 at base 220.
Described fixed line signal digital modular converter 130 is converted to digitally encoded signal with the signal of telecommunication on the telephone wire on the one hand, processes and be forwarded to mobile phone 300 for main control module; The signal of telecommunication on the described telephone wire is the fixed line signal of base 220 namely, comprises the user's operation information on voice signal and the base 220, such as command transmitting signal and voice signal; On the other hand, described fixed line signal digital modular converter 130 also can be converted to the digitally encoded signal that main control module 120 sends command transmitting signal and the voice signal of telephone wire, be sent on the base 220, thus the mobile phone of realization base 220 answering cell phones 300.
Further, on described mobile phone fixed line conversion equipment 100, also be provided with a power transfer module that is used for to mobile phone 300 chargings.Described power transfer module is used for civil power is converted to mobile phone 300 required electric energy, thereby charges for the battery of mobile phone 300.Can be at the mobile phone fixed line conversion equipment 100 above-mentioned interfaces that are used for to mobile phone 300 chargings that arrange, described power transfer module connects this interface, thereby is embodied as mobile phone 300 chargings.
Further, on described mobile phone fixed line conversion equipment 100, also be provided with one for the deconcentrator module that the fixed line signal is separated with network signal.Described deconcentrator module is used for the fixed line signal is separated with network signal, so that mobile phone fixed line conversion equipment 100 also has the function of deconcentrator.
Further, described main control module 120 comprises whether one have the detecting unit of incoming call for detection of mobile phone; Described detecting unit connects mobile communication module 110.
See also Fig. 2, as shown in the figure, specifically, described fixed line signal digital modular converter 130 comprises: be used for the fixed line signal of base 220 is converted to the A/D convertor circuit 131 that digitally encoded signal sends to main control module 120, be used for digitally encoded signal is converted to the DA change-over circuit 132 that the fixed line signal sends to base 220, for switching on or off the fixed line control circuit 133 that be connected of switch 210 with base 220, be used for being connected with switch 210 judging whether incoming call decision circuitry 134 that base 220 sends a telegram here and the push button signalling observation circuit 135 that is connected being connected to come with base 220 push button signalling of monitor user '; Described main control module 120, A/D convertor circuit 131 and push button signalling observation circuit are connected successively and are connected; Described DA change-over circuit 132, fixed line control circuit 133 and the decision circuitry 134 of being connected connect respectively main control module 120.Described A/D convertor circuit 131 and DA change-over circuit are connected between base 220 and the main control module 120 respectively.Described AD(Analog to Digital) change-over circuit 131 analog to digital conversion circuit namely converts analog signal (the fixed line signal of base) to digital signal (digitally encoded signal).Described DA(Digital to Analog) change-over circuit 132, namely D/A converting circuit is converted to analog signal (the fixed line signal of base) with digital signal (data of mobile phone), thereby so that base can answering cell phone mobile phone.Described A/D convertor circuit 131 also connects base 220 by push button signalling observation circuit 135, and described DA change-over circuit 132, fixed line control circuit 133 and the decision circuitry 134 of being connected also connect respectively base 220.Further, described fixed line signal digital modular converter 130 also comprises a Tip element for the audio signal of having sent suggesting effect; Described Tip element connects the incoming call decision circuitry.
Described fixed line signal digital modular converter 130 is converted to digitally encoded signal by A/D convertor circuit with the fixed line signal, wherein, the fixed line signal comprises: the control information of command transmitting signal, voice signal and user's input etc., wherein signaling-information comprises bell signal, DTMF(dual-tone multi frequency, dual-tone multifrequency) etc.The digitally encoded signal that described DA change-over circuit sends main control module 120 is converted to the fixed line signal and sends to base.Described fixed line control circuit is connected between base and the switch, has when incoming call to cut off being connected of switch and base at mobile phone; When mobile phone was not sent a telegram here, the connection switch was connected with base.The signal of described incoming call decision circuitry monitoring switch incoming telephone line has judged whether the base incoming call.Described push button signalling observation circuit is connected between base and the main control module 120, is used for the upper user's of base push button signalling is sent to main control module 120, sends to mobile phone through main control module 120 identifying processings after, thereby realizes the operation of correspondence.Described fixed line signal digital modular converter 130 can also be sneaked into the audio signal of suggesting effect under the control of main control module 120 under the channel status before cut-out switch and the base, thus reminding user.
The operation principle of the mobile phone fixed line conversion equipment that the utility model provides is as follows: when mobile phone without putting through enters mobile phone fixed line conversion equipment 100, perhaps mobile phone accessed mobile phone fixed line conversion equipment 100 but when not yet cell phone incoming call being arranged, main control module 120 control fixed line signal digital modular converters 130 direct paths are so that the fixed line signal of telecommunication of switch can be through to base 220.Then the operating state of base 220 and original telephone set operating state are just the same, all are the fixed line signals of desampler.
In the time of mobile phone access mobile phone fixed line conversion equipment and cell phone incoming call and the current incoming call that does not have base, main control module 120 control fixed line signal digital modular converters 130 cut off switches is connected connection with base, and at the bell signal of telephone wire output simulation so that the base jingle bell.When the user mentioned microphone, fixed line signal digital modular converter 130 converted off hook signal to digitally encoded signal and sends to main control module 120.Main control module 120 identifying processings are the data of speech data and the control mobile phone of conversation, connect cell phone incoming call by mobile communication module 110 control mobile phones.Then main control module 120 control fixed line signal digital modular converters 130 and mobile communication module 110 realize the two-way interactive of voice signal.Complete when user's communication, after the microphone on-hook, main control module 120 is checked through coherent signal according to fixed line signal digital modular converter 130 to be changed, then sending controling instruction so that mobile phone also hang up the telephone.
The mobile phone fixed line conversion equipment that is using the utility model to provide as the user carries out under the state of cell phone incoming call conversation, the telephone signal that main control module 120 is still inputted by fixed line signal digital modular converter 130 monitoring switches.If base incoming call is arranged, then main control module 120 is sneaked into cue in originally being transmitted to the cell phone incoming call voice signal of user's base, such as the loudspeaker that main control module 120 drives mobile phone fixed line conversion equipments point out, and reminding user has the base incoming call.Preferably, if the user need to keep mobile phone communication to answer first the base incoming call, can be by the button that presets such as # or ※, or other combination of numbers, so that main control module 120 wouldn't be hung up mobile phone communication, master control this moment mould 120 is connected the base incoming call by sending the imitate pick machine signal to switch, and control rapidly fixed line signal digital modular converter 130 with circuit switching for " switch-base ", realize the base conversation.When the base talk-through, the user is switched the machine of turning round and stretching out the hand by the button that presets again and is conversed.When the user under the mobile phone communication state, base incoming call, and the user wishes to cut off first mobile phone communication, directly on-hook.After described main control module 120 detects on-hook signal, corresponding control mobile phone kill-call at once, and control fixed line signal digital modular converter 130 is " switch-base " with circuit switching, so that the bell signal of switch can make the base jingle bell, the user mentions microphone can realize the base conversation.
Under the state of user in base conversation, if cell phone incoming call is arranged, the user can be notified by ringing sound of cell phone, can select to pick up mobile phone and directly connect, and perhaps hangs up base and waits for answering cell phone incoming call behind the main control module 120 control base jingle bells.
